Transaction

eedb3e9afe7b4eaf1ace756a5ef2fca190031928d276aca3b61d0e57760fd2b9
429,046 confirmations
Timestamp
1519168629
Block510,140
Fee1,035 sats
Fee rate2.78 sats/vB
view on mempool.space

Inputs & Outputs